    An increasingly common special-purpose OPM, commonly called a "PON Power Meter" is designed to hook into a live PON (Passive Optical Network) circuit, and simultaneously test the optical power in different directions and wavelengths. This unit is essentially a triple power meter, with a collection of wavelength filters and optical couplers. Proper calibration is complicated by the varying duty cycl. OverviewAn optical power meter (OPM) is a device used to measure the power in an signal. The term usually refers to a device. The major types are (Si), (Ge) and (InGaAs). Additionally, these may be used with attenuating elements for high optical power testing, or wavelengt. A typical OPM is linear from about 0 dBm (1 milli Watt) to about -50 dBm (10 nano Watt), although the display range may be larger.     Next Generation Firewalls (NGFW) are enhanced versions of standard firewalls that include features such as in-line deep packet inspection, intrusion detection, website filtering, and more. They not only identify but also completely block malicious packets before they enter your. A next-generation firewall (NGFW) is a network security device that identifies and controls applications, users, and content to enforce precise security policies. It inspects traffic beyond ports and protocols to detect threats and prevent misuse of legitimate applications.
